    Principle of energy saving evaporation by MVR evaporator

    The principle of energy-saving evaporation of MVR evaporator MVR evaporator is a new type of energy-saving evaporation equipment mainly used in the pharmaceutical industry The equipment uses low-temperature and low-pressure steam evaporation technology and clean energy as the energy to generate steam and separate the water in the medium It is an internationally advanced evaporation technology MVR evaporator is short for mechanical vapor recommendation in English MVR is a technology to reuse the energy of secondary steam generated by itself, so as to reduce the demand for external energy The secondary steam is compressed by the compressor, the pressure and temperature are increased, and the enthalpy is increased accordingly It is sent to the heating chamber of the evaporator as the heating steam, i.e raw steam, to maintain the evaporation state of the material liquid, while the heating steam itself transfers the heat to the material itself and condenses it into water In this way, the original steam to be discarded is fully utilized, the latent heat is recovered, and the thermal efficiency is improved As early as the 1960s, Germany and France have successfully applied this technology to chemical industry, pharmaceutical industry, papermaking, sewage treatment, desalination and other industries The working process is that the steam at low temperature is compressed by the compressor, the temperature and pressure are increased, the enthalpy is increased, and then it enters the heat exchanger for condensation, so as to make full use of the latent heat of the steam In addition to start-up, there is no need to generate steam during the whole evaporation process In the process of multi effect evaporation, the secondary steam of one effect of the evaporator can not be directly used as the heat source of the primary effect, but only as the heat source of the secondary effect or the secondary effect If it is used as the heat source of this effect, it must be given extra energy to increase its temperature (pressure) The steam jet pump can only compress part of the secondary steam, while the MVR evaporator can compress all the secondary steam in the evaporator The solution is in a falling film evaporator and circulates in the heating pipe through the material circulation pump The initial steam is heated outside the pipe with fresh steam, and the solution is heated and boiled to generate secondary steam The secondary steam is drawn in by the turbocharged fan After being pressurized, the temperature of the secondary steam is increased, and it enters the heating chamber as the heating heat source for circulating evaporation After normal start-up, the secondary steam is sucked in by the turbo compressor, and then it becomes heated steam after pressurization, so the cycle evaporation is carried out continuously The evaporated water will eventually become condensed water and be discharged.
